John Sigismund, Elector of Brandenburg

John Sigismund (German: Johann Sigismund) (8 November, 1572 – 23 December, 1619) was Elector of Brandenburg from the House of Hohenzollern.
He was born in Halle an der Saale to Joachim Frederick, Elector of Brandenburg and his first wife Catherine, Princess of Brandenburg-Küstrin. He succeeded his father as margrave of Brandenburg in 1608. He gave the Reichshof Castrop to his teacher and educator Carl Friedrich von Bordelius. He became Duke of Cleves in 1614. He succeeded his father-in-law as Duke of Prussia in 1618. He held all three titles until his death.
[edit] Family and children
On 30 October, 1594, John Sigismund married Anna Amalia of Prussia, daughter of Albert Frederick, Duke of Prussia (1553–1618). They were parents to eight children:
- George William of Brandenburg (13 November, 1595 – 1 December, 1640). His successor.
- Anne Sophia of Brandenburg (15 March, 1598 – 19 December, 1659). Married Frederick Ulrich, Duke of Brunswick-Lüneburg.
- Maria Eleonora of Brandenburg (11 November, 1599 – 28 March, 1655). Married Gustavus Adolphus of Sweden. They were parents of Christina of Sweden.
- Catharina of Brandenburg (28 May, 1602 – 27 August, 1644). Married first Gabriel Bethlen, Prince of Transylvania and secondly Franz Karl of Saxe-Lauenburg.
- Joachim Sigismund of Brandenburg (25 July, 1603 – 22 February, 1625).
- Agnes of Brandenburg (31 August, 1606 – 12 March, 1607).
- John Frederick of Brandenburg (18 August, 1607 – 1 March, 1608).
- Albrecht Christian of Brandenburg (7 March – 14 March, 1609).
